Population breakdown by gender

Population in zip code 20619 is 9,817 residents | Male to Female ratio is 1:1.15 | Zip Code 20619 land area is 15.6437 sq. miles | Population density is 627.54 residents per square mile

Median age

  Median Age
Zip Code Median Age 32.9
Median Age - Male 33.1
Median Age - Female 32.5

Median age of zip code 20619 is 25.2% lower compared to nearby zip codes and 11.6% lower compared to the United States median age. Comparing gender-specific madian age yields the following results. Male median age of zip code 20619 is 23.6% lower compared to nearby zip codes and 7.5% lower compared to the United States male median age. Female zip code 20619 median age is 26.3% lower in comparison to nearby zip codes and 15.6% lower compared to female national median age average.

Real Estate

Metric Value
Housing occupied 93.42%
Housing vacant 6.58%
Housing occupied by owner 66.6%
Housing occupied by tenant 33.4%
Total Rented Units 1272
Median Contract Gross Rent $1,275
Median Gross Rent $1,474
Median Home Value $302,000

Contract rent is the monthly cash rent agreed to, regardless of any furnishings, utilities, fees, meals, or services that may be included. Gross rent is the contract rent plus the estimated average monthly cost of utilities and fuels if these are paid by the renter. In zip code 20619 median gross rent is 15.61% larger then the median contract rent.
